The Shift to Automated Ironing in Gazipur's Garment Factories

Automated ironing is transforming Gazipur's garment industry, significantly improving efficiency and quality. This shift is crucial for meeting global demand and enhancing competitive edge.

Introduction

As the global fashion industry continues to evolve, the traditional methods of garment production face increasing pressure to innovate. In Gazipur, a key hub for garment manufacturing in Bangladesh, factories are making a notable shift from manual ironing to automated processes. This transition is not just a matter of modernization; it is a strategic move to enhance productivity and meet the growing demands of international markets.

Why Automation Matters Now

The shift towards automated ironing in Gazipur is essential in light of recent market trends. As brands worldwide seek faster turnaround times and higher quality standards, the ability to efficiently process garments becomes a competitive advantage. With Southeast Asia rapidly emerging as a central player in the global apparel market, particularly in regions like Jakarta, Surabaya, and Bali, Gazipur's factories must adapt to maintain their status.

Enhancing Quality and Efficiency

Automated ironing equipment allows factories to achieve consistent quality, reducing the risk of human error that often accompanies manual processes. This consistency is vital for brands that rely on uniformity in their collections, ensuring that every piece meets stringent quality controls.

Meeting Global Demand

With global consumer preferences shifting towards faster fashion cycles, the need for quicker production times is imperative. Automated ironing can significantly reduce the time garments spend in production, enabling factories to meet tight deadlines imposed by brands.

Economic Impact on the Region

Automation in Gazipur not only benefits individual factories but also positively impacts the broader economy. As production becomes more streamlined, there is potential for increased exports, particularly to markets in ASEAN countries. This can lead to job creation in other sectors as the economy grows in response to a booming garment industry.

Challenges and Considerations

While the benefits of automation are clear, there are challenges that factories must navigate. Initial investment costs for automated machinery can be substantial, and training workers to operate these new systems is essential for maximizing efficiency. Moreover, there is the ongoing concern of job displacement, as automated processes may reduce the need for manual labor.

Balancing Automation and Employment

To address these concerns, it is crucial for stakeholders in the garment industry to strike a balance between embracing new technology and providing adequate support for their workforce. Investing in training programs can help workers transition into roles that complement automated processes, ensuring that the workforce remains skilled and adaptable.
